Shahla Pazokifard is a scholar working on Renewable Energy, Sustainability and the Environment, Organic Chemistry and Polymers and Plastics. According to data from OpenAlex, Shahla Pazokifard has authored 22 papers receiving a total of 524 indexed citations (citations by other indexed papers that have themselves been cited), including 9 papers in Renewable Energy, Sustainability and the Environment, 8 papers in Organic Chemistry and 8 papers in Polymers and Plastics. Recurrent topics in Shahla Pazokifard’s work include TiO2 Photocatalysis and Solar Cells (9 papers), Advanced Photocatalysis Techniques (8 papers) and Advanced Polymer Synthesis and Characterization (5 papers). Shahla Pazokifard is often cited by papers focused on TiO2 Photocatalysis and Solar Cells (9 papers), Advanced Photocatalysis Techniques (8 papers) and Advanced Polymer Synthesis and Characterization (5 papers). Shahla Pazokifard collaborates with scholars based in Iran, Canada and United States. Shahla Pazokifard's co-authors include S.M. Mirabedini, Masoud Esfandeh, M. J. Zohuriaan‐Mehr, Ramin Farnood and Saba Goharshenas Moghadam and has published in prestigious journals such as Journal of Materials Science, RSC Advances and Journal of Applied Polymer Science.
